Abstract:Successfully transitioning to a cloud-native architecture demands more than just new tools--it requires a change in mindset. Written by cloud transformation experts Gerald Bachlmayr, Aiden Ziegelaar, Alan Blockley, and Bojan Zivic--each with extensive experience in cloud transformation, AWS technologies, and DevOps practices, this guide shows you how to identify and remediate cloud anti-patterns, steering your organization to become truly cloud native. You'll start by exploring the events that shaped our understanding of the modern cloud-native stack. Through practical examples, you'll learn how to establish a solid strategy, implement a suitable governance model, adopt FinOps practices, foster a mature DevSecOps culture, and automate security and compliance measures. For each domain, you'll identify common anti-patterns and refactor them into best practices. The book then examines how to evolve application, data, and networking tiers from potential pitfalls into solutions that enhance business agility. You'll also gain expert insights into observability, operations, migrations, and testing of cloud-native solutions. By the end of this book, you'll possess the knowledge to spot anti-patterns, develop effective remediation strategies, and confidently guide your organization to cloud-native success.
